325.7. 标头和附加传播
自版本 2.10.3 起,Spring WS Camel 支持将标头和附件传播到 Spring-WS WebServiceMessage 响应中。端点将使用名为"hook" (默认实施由 BasicMessageFilter 提供)来传播交换标头和附件到 WebServiceMessage 响应。现在,您可以使用
exchange.getOut().getHeaders().put("myCustom","myHeaderValue")
exchange.getIn().addAttachment("myAttachment", new DataHandler(...))
注: 如果管道中的交换标头包含文本,它会在 soap 标头中生成 Qname (key)=value 属性。建议直接创建一个 QName 类,并将其放在标头中。